I just moved my cabin from a Sea Terrace XL on the 8th deck right above the Red Room, as I was warned numerous times that it can and will get quite noisy. My new cabin is also a Sea Terrace XL but on deck 11. They warned me that it is a cabin that sleeps 3 people... there was no upcharge but now I'm wondering why they felt they needed to 'warn' me that there's an extra bed- he told me it was just a sofa that would convert to a bed so I'm thinking it's a pretty similar configuration as the XL that sleeps 2... are any of you familiar with the layout of the XL that sleeps 3? Am I going to be unhappy with it?

There is almost no difference to the configuration. The sleeps three rooms have an ottoman that folds out onto the section of that sofa that is only used when the bed is in sofa mode. The ottoman cube thing means there is no armchair in the room.
